Ermenegildo Zegna Q2 Earnings Call Highlights

TOM FORD FASHION generated EUR 89 million in second-quarter revenue, up 7% organically. Durante said DTC revenue increased 13%, led mainly by the Americas, with the rest of APAC outperforming. She said the performance was driven entirely by comparable store sales growth and supported by customer reception of the spring/summer collections. Wholesale revenue declined 3%, and management reiterated expectations for a low- to mid-single-digit decline by year-end.
